The Mars Science Laboratory (MSL), known as Curiosity, is a NASA rover scheduled to be launched between October and December 2011 and perform the first-ever precision landing on Mars.The MSL rover will be over five times as heavy and carry over ten times the weight in scientific instruments as one of the Mars Exploration Rovers. It will carry more advanced scientific instruments than any other mission to Mars to date, including instruments for the analysis of samples scooped up from the soil and drilled powders from rocks. It will also investigate the past or present ability of Mars to support microbial life. The United States, Canada, Germany, France, Russia and Spain will provide the instruments on board.The MSL rover will be launched by an Atlas V 541 rocket and will be expected to operate for at least 1 Martian year (668 Martian sols/686 Earth days) as it explores with greater range than any previous Mars rover. The New York Times has reported that the total cost of the MSL is about $2.3 billion USD.The Mars Science Laboratory project is managed by N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ory, Pasadena, Calif., for NASA's Science Mission Directorate in Washington.
